diluvsdiscounts wrote: »Do you know if you can use a gift card to pay your credit card bill?
There may be off exceptions but generally no. I seem to recall people were able to pay off Next store cards with them? The Visa cards may work (3V prepaid have been blocked for most financial transactions but the other Visa with a fee can apparently still work with some financial transactions).
